Types of Advance Directives The living will. Durable power of attorney for health care/Medical power of attorney. POLST (Physician Orders for Life-Sustaining Treatment) Do not resuscitate (DNR) orders. Organ and tissue donation.
The Five Wishes Wish 1: The Person I Want to Make Care Decisions for Me When I Cant. Wish 2: The Kind of Medical Treatment I Want or Dont Want. Wish 3: How Comfortable I Want to Be. Wish 4: How I Want People to Treat Me. Wish 5: What I Want My Loved Ones to Know.
Five Wishes is legal in New Jersey, Pennsylvania, and Delaware. Why should I complete Five Wishes? A living will, like Five Wishes, is a way for you to give consent for certain situations where you might want or not want treatment. You can appoint someone to make decisions for you, if you cant do so for yourself.
Five Wishes is unique among all other living will and healthcare agent forms because it speaks to all of a persons needs: medical, personal, emotional and spiritual. Five Wishes also helps to guide and structure discussions with your family and physician, making conversations easier.
Just like Five Wishes, it is a type of advance directive that covers your preferences. Unlike medical power of attorney documents, Five Wishes goes beyond just medical and healthcare topics to express spiritual, emotional and personal wishes. It aims to be a more holistic way of planning for the end of life.

Is the Five Wishes advance directive a legal document? Yes. It was written with the help of the American Bar Associations Commission on Law Aging. It meets the legal requirements of 46 states, but is used widely in all 50, and a federal law requires medical care providers to honor patient wishes as expressed.
Types of Advance Directives The living will. Durable power of attorney for health care/Medical power of attorney. POLST (Physician Orders for Life-Sustaining Treatment) Do not resuscitate (DNR) orders. Organ and tissue donation.
Five Wishes is a legal document in all states but eight. Alabama, Indiana, Kansas, New Hampshire, Ohio, Oregon, Texas and Utah all require their own official documentation. Once you get started filling out your own Five Wishes document, youll have many important decisions to make.
Advance directives generally fall into three categories: living will, power of attorney and health care proxy.
